A driver dies following a crash during the MSCA Super Sprint Championship round at Calder Park on Sunday. Multiple outlets report that what began as a motorsport racing day ends in tragedy after the crash occurs during the championship event. The incident takes place at Calder Park, with the death confirmed after the crash. While the reports note the fatal outcome, they do not provide further consistent details about the driver’s identity, the specific circumstances of the crash, or the exact section of track involved. The crash is described as occurring during the Super Sprint Championship program, indicating it is part of the scheduled competition rather than an off-track incident. The reports focus on the fatality, the event timing, and the location, without outlining additional injuries to other participants or spectators.
